Implementing the recommended data set placements

As you plan how you will implement the recommended data set placements, be sure to include the following activities:
  • Decide whether to merge data sets.
  • Determine which data sets to move and where to move them.
  • Choose a volume serial naming convention if you plan to use indirect volume serial support.
  • Decide whether to use your existing master catalog.
  • Move data sets to appropriate volumes.
  • Update SMP/E DDDEFs.
  • Update catalog entries to point to appropriate volumes.
  • Update IEASYMxx in your parmlib, using volume naming conventions.
  • If using ServerPac or SystemPac (dump-by-data-set format), save your configuration for the next release.
  • Update any environmentals that are applicable.
